Sprague [New London County] was incorporated from Lisbon and Franklin in 1861 and named from W. Sprage, village founder.
Area, 13.8 sq. miles. Population, est., 2,876. Voting Districts, 1. Principal industries, agriculture and manufacture of paper board and boxes, lithographing, and engraving.
Sprague includes the areas known as Baltic, Hanover and Versailles.
